Description / Scope of Work

Pakistan State Oil Company Limited invites quotations for the procurement of firefighting equipment for PSO EJHD, Karachi Aviation Station, under RFQ No. IP-19885IA (SAP No. 6100017797). The scope includes supply of 16 fire water hydrants and 8 fire water/foam water monitors. The fire water hydrants are wet barrel type pillars made of seamless Schedule 40 pipe (API5L GR. B material) with 6-inch diameter inlet bottom flanges, two outlet nozzles of 2.5-inch diameter, and two bronze body globe hydrant valves per unit, manufactured to BS5154 and BS5041 Part 1 standards. Each hydrant must be hydrostatic tested at 250 PSIG for a minimum of 5 minutes in accordance with NFPA 24 standards and supplied with third-party inspection certificates. The fire water monitors must deliver 750 USGPM flow capacity, constructed from stainless steel 316L, bronze or brass, with 360-degree sweep and 80 degrees upward plus 30 degrees downward vertical movement, finished in fire brigade red (RAL 3002), and capable of handling both water and foam with self-educting hydro foam nozzles. Both products must be corrosion-protected through surface preparation (ISO8501-1 SA-2-1/2 standard), zinc-rich epoxy primer (minimum 120 DFT), epoxy mastic (minimum 100 DFT), and polyurethane topcoat (minimum 60 DFT in red shade). The procurement is located in Karachi, Sindh province.

Vendor is required to supply 16 fire water hydrants and 8 foam/water monitors to PSO's Karachi aviation station.

The contract demands FM or UL certification for monitors, compliance with NFPA 24 and British Standards (BS5154, BS5041) for hydrants, and material test certificates from original equipment manufacturers. Notably, vendor must arrange and demonstrate a sample unit at PSO's designated location at own cost before procurement can proceed—approval is mandatory. All hydrants require witnessed hydrostatic testing. This is a medium-scale procurement with stringent quality, testing, and certification requirements typical of aviation safety-critical applications.
